Actress Shefali Jariwala died last week. Recently, in an interview, Shefali had taken the IV drip of vitamin C on that day i.e. on the day of death.

In an interview to Vicky Lalwani, Pooja Ghai said, “Look, I think it is not right to comment on someone’s such personal thing, but I live in Dubai and good that now I am not an actress, I do not need it, but I think everyone takes it and perhaps everyone needs it. There is common practice that people do. “

Pooja- Taking vitamin C is very normal That day he had drip, vitamin C, but as I said, it is a very normal thing to take vitamin C. We all take not vitamin C? After Kovid, people have started taking even more regular. I also take vitamin C myself. Some people take tablets and some take through IV drip.

When she was asked the question at what time Shefali took the drip, Pooja said, “I don’t know how many minutes or hours ago. Just know that she had taken that day because when I was standing there, the police called the man who had drip her, so that she would find out what she had given.
